How Our Sewage Water Removal Process Works
When sewage water damage strikes, it’s essential to act fast to prevent further damage and contamination.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ure your home is restored to its original condition. First, we’ll assess the situation and develop a customized plan to address the issue. Next, our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ract the sewage water, followed by a thorough cleaning and disinfection of the affected area. Finally, we’ll work with you to ensure your home is restored to its original condition, including any necessary repairs or replacements.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your home, assess the situation, and develop a customized plan to address the issue. We’ll identify the source of the problem, find out the extent of the damage, and create a timeline for the restoration process. Expert assessment ensures that our team is equipped to handle even the most complex sewage water removal projects.
Step 2: Equipment Setup and Extraction
Our technicians will set up specialized equipment to extract the sewage water, including pumps, hoses, and containment systems. We’ll work efficiently to remove the water and prevent further damage, reducing downtime and ensuring a safe environment for your family.
Step 3: Cleaning and Disinfection
Once the sewage water has been extracted, our team will thoroughly clean and disinfect the affected area to prevent further contamination and damage. We’ll use state-of-the-art cleaning solutions to ensure your home is restored to its original condition.
Step 4: Repairs and Reconstruction
Finally, our team will work with you to ensure your home is restored to its original condition, including any necessary repairs or replacements. We’ll coordinate with local contractors to ensure seamless communication and efficient completion of the project.

Sewage Water Removal Cost in Carrollton, TX
The cost of sewage water removal in Carrollton, TX,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team offers free estimates to ensure you know exactly what to expect. Don’t wait until it’s too late act fast to prevent further damage and contamination.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and planning |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Equipment setup and ext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and disinfection |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ning solutions needed |
| Repairs and reconstruction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age, type of repairs needed |
| Emergency services |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, time of day/night |
| Free estimates | $0 – $0 | Initial consultation and assessment |
